How to get from Gianicolense/Ravizza to San Vito Romano by bus and metro?

By bus and metro

To get from Gianicolense/Ravizza to San Vito Romano in San Vito Romano,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one metro line: take the 792 bus from Gianicolense/Ravizza station to Porta S. Giovanni (Ma)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the C metro and finally take the COTRAL bus from Grotte Celoni (Mc) station to San Vito | Via Vittorio Emanuele station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 49 min. The ride fare is €4.90.
